The Charm of Necklaces
A necklace is a piece of jewelry worn around the neck, often made of metal, string, or other materials and decorated with beads, pearls, gemstones, etc. It is one of the most popular types of jewelry, with a history spanning thousands of years. From ancient civilizations like Egypt and Mesopotamia to modern times, necklaces have always been an important accessory for people to showcase their style and personality.

Types of Necklaces
Choker
Chokers are usually 14 to 16 inches in length and worn close to the neck. They can complement any neckline and are suitable for various occasions, from casual outings to formal events. Chokers can be made of leather, gold, velvet, or thick string, offering both casual and formal options. Their close-fitting design makes them a versatile choice for any outfit.
Collar Necklace
Collar necklaces are short, typically 12 to 13 inches in length, and often consist of three or more strands of pearls or other materials. They encircle the neck like a crewneck sweater, hence the name. Collar necklaces can be formal or casual, depending on the materials used. They are ideal for off-the-shoulder outfits, turtleneck sweaters, boat necks, or V-necks.
Graduated Necklace
As the name suggests, graduated necklaces feature beads or decorative pieces that increase in size from the clasp to the other end. They can be single-strand or multi-layered, with each layer extending further down the blouse or shirt. Graduated necklaces look elegant and are suitable for both casual and formal occasions, though they shine particularly well with formal attire.
Lariat Necklace
Lariat necklaces are scarf-like, with no clasp points. They wrap around the neck and have one strand hanging down the front. Sometimes called lasso necklaces, they often have a Y-shape and may feature a pendant or charm at the bottom. They are perfect for U-shaped necklines and can be worn for both casual and formal events.
Tassel Necklaces
Tassel necklaces have tassels at the end of various chains. They are bold and versatile, suitable for everything from t-shirts to silk blouses. The tassels can be made of gold or silver chains, basic strings, feathers, or embroidery thread, offering a variety of sizes and colors to match different occasions.
Thread Necklace
Thread necklaces are made of thick threads tied in a knot at the neckline, eliminating the need for eyelets or other fastenings. They can be adorned with silver pendants, large beads, or items made of silver, wood, or metal. Thread necklaces are usually between 14 and 20 inches long and are great for casual dresses or blouses.
Statement Necklace
Statement necklaces are bold, attention-grabbing pieces designed to serve as the centerpiece of an outfit. They often feature oversized gemstones, intricate metalwork, dimensional layers, or mixed materials. While traditionally associated with eveningwear, they are now commonly used to elevate casual outfits.
Bib Collar Necklace
Bib collar necklaces feature a symmetrical arrangement of decorative elements like beads or pearls that encircle the neck and chest area. They are ideal for formal events, evening gatherings, weddings, or high-end business settings. They are typically worn alone due to their bold style and pair well with off-the-shoulder and scoop necklines.
Slider Necklace
Slider necklaces have an adjustable movable bead or clasp, allowing you to adjust the length of the pendant as desired. They have a V-shape and are extremely compatible with short or thick necklaces. Slider necklaces are suitable for casual outings and work events and pair well with casual tops, dresses, or blouses.
Fringe Necklace
Fringe necklaces feature a series of pendant elements that hang from links or a cord around the neck. They can be made of thread, leather, chains, etc. Fringe necklaces are high-energy and elegantly designed, perfect for parades and festivals. They can be layered with other boho-style accessories and work best with V-necks and strapless tops.
Necklace Materials
Gold
Gold is a classic and luxurious material for necklaces. However, its softness makes it less durable for everyday wear, and it is prone to bending or deforming. Gold alloys containing nickel may cause allergic reactions in sensitive individuals. Solid gold chains are the most durable, but they can be heavy and expensive. Hollow gold chains are lighter and more affordable.
Platinum
Platinum is highly regarded for its rarity, strength, and enduring white sheen. It is hypoallergenic and doesn’t tarnish over time. Platinum necklaces are ideal for everyday wear due to their durability and resistance to scratches and dents. However, platinum is more expensive than many other metals.
Silver
Silver is a popular and affordable material for necklaces. It has a beautiful white sheen and is relatively durable. However, silver can tarnish over time and may require regular cleaning to maintain its shine.
Stainless Steel
Stainless steel is known for its durability and resistance to tarnishing. It is hypoallergenic and offers a modern, sleek look. Stainless steel necklaces are lightweight and comfortable to wear, making them suitable for everyday use.
Titanium
Titanium is a strong and lightweight metal that is resistant to corrosion and tarnishing. It is hypoallergenic and offers a unique, contemporary appearance. Titanium necklaces are ideal for those seeking a durable and low-maintenance option.
Beads and Pearls
Beads and pearls are versatile materials used in necklaces. They come in various colors, shapes, and sizes, allowing for endless design possibilities. Pearl necklaces, in particular, exude elegance and sophistication. Pearl necklaces can be paired with a sheath dress or a blouse with a crisp collar for a polished look, or layered with other casual necklaces for a touch of effortless elegance.

Necklace Styles and How to Style Them
Pendant Necklaces
Pendant necklaces feature a single pendant or charm hanging from a chain. They can be dressed up or down depending on the occasion. For a casual look, pair a pendant necklace with jeans and a t-shirt. For a more formal look, wear it with a sleek dress or blouse.
Tennis Necklaces
Tennis necklaces are a symbol of elegance, featuring a single strand of diamonds or gemstones linked together. They are perfect for adding a touch of luxury to any outfit. Pair a tennis necklace with a little black dress for a classic evening look or wear it over your favorite blouse for a sophisticated work outfit.
Multi-Strand Necklaces
Multi-strand necklaces combine multiple strands of chains, beads, or other materials into a single necklace. They create a layered and dimensional look. These necklaces can be paired with a simple, close-fitting top or layered over a flowy blouse to add texture and interest.
Charm Necklaces
Charm necklaces allow for self-expression through a collection of trinkets. The base is a delicate chain from which individual charms dangle. Charm necklaces are versatile and can be dressed up or down. They are ideal for showcasing personal significance and style.
Riviere Necklaces
Riviere necklaces feature a continuous loop of dazzling gemstones. They exude luxury and grandeur and are perfect for formal occasions. Pair a Riviere necklace with a strapless dress or plunging neckline for a dramatic evening look or with a crisp white shirt and slacks for daytime sophistication.
How to Choose the Perfect Necklace
Personal Style
Choose necklaces that reflect your aesthetic preferences and can easily integrate into your wardrobe. Whether you prefer bold statement pieces or delicate, minimalist designs, there is a necklace style to suit every personal taste.
Neckline Compatibility
Different necklines pair well with different necklace styles. V-necks go well with pendant necklaces that echo the neckline’s shape. High necklines favor longer chains or statement pieces. Strapless or off-the-shoulder garments are enhanced by collar necklaces or chokers. Simple round necklines accommodate a wide range of necklace styles.
Occasion
The occasion will also influence your choice of necklace. For everyday wear, opt for versatile pieces like simple chains, delicate pendants, or station necklaces. For professional settings, choose polished, understated designs. For formal events, reserve more elaborate pieces like tennis necklaces, graduated strands, and statement necklaces that can take center stage.

Q5: What is the difference between gold-plated and gold-filled necklaces?
A5: Gold-plated necklaces have a thin layer of gold on the outside, while gold-filled necklaces have a thicker layer of gold over a base metal, usually brass. Gold-filled necklaces are more durable and less likely to tarnish or chip compared to gold-plated necklaces. They also have a more genuine shine and are a better value for those seeking a gold appearance without the high cost of solid gold.
